• DocumentCode
    1984731
  • Title

    Reification of program points for visual execution

  • Author

    Diehl, Stephan ; Kerren, Andreas

  • Author_Institution
    Comput. Sci. Dept., Saarlandes Univ., Saarbrucken, Germany
  • fYear
    2002
  • fDate
    2002
  • Firstpage
    100
  • Lastpage
    109
  • Abstract
    Existing reification techniques for Java only allow for the inspection and manipulation of Java programs on the class, object and method level, but not at the level of individual program points. In this paper we introduce a reification technique of program points based on source-to-source transformations. Our reification method allows for the association of arbitrary meta-information with program points and to manipulate it during execution. We present examples of the innovative use of such reified program points for visualizing the execution of Java programs.
  • Keywords
    Java; data visualisation; meta data; object-oriented programming; GANIMAL system; Java programs; control flow statements; meta information; reification technique; software visualisation; source-to source transformations; visual program execution; Algorithm design and analysis; Animation; Computer architecture; Computer science; Education; Inspection; Java; Prototypes; Runtime; Visualization;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Visualizing Software for Understanding and Analysis, 2002. Proceedings. First International Workshop on
  • Print_ISBN
    0-7695-1662-9
  • Type

    conf

  • DOI
    10.1109/VISSOF.2002.1019799
  • Filename
    1019799